Yeah, I've built a system around the Core i7-13700F recently. The CPU performs great for gaming and content creation. The TDP of 65 watts at base frequency and 219 watts at max turbo frequency should be fine for most use cases.

Thanks for the input, @OldElvis. I'm interested in knowing more about selecting a power supply based on the TDP. Can you recommend a suitable PSU?

Based on my experience with building PCs, it's essential to choose a power supply with a wattage rating higher than the max turbo TDP of your CPU. So for the Core i7-13700F, I would go for at least 750 watts.

That's really helpful, @RenegadeBeaver. I appreciate the link! So, let's say I go for a 750-watt PSU. Would that be enough for other components like GPU and RAM as well?

Typically, you'll need to consider the wattage requirements of your GPU and RAM in addition to your CPU's TDP. Make sure to check the specifications of the components you plan to use and add up their recommended power supply ratings.

Good point, @OldElvis. It's always a good idea to go for a PSU with a little extra capacity than what's strictly necessary to accommodate any potential future upgrades or changes in usage patterns.
